#964 | Ed and Dharnish analyse United's impressive 2-0 victory over City, marking Michael Carrick's first game in charge. The discussion highlights the tactical brilliance that led to the win, including the smart counter-attacking setup and notable performances from players like Bruno Fernandes, Bryan Mbeumo, Harry Maguire, and Casemiro. The episode also touches on the tactical changes Carrick made in just three training sessions. They explore the strategic depth of 'Carrick Ball,' with a focus on setup, formation, and key player roles in nullifying City's strengths. Looking ahead, the episode considers the challenges United may face in maintaining this momentum, particularly in their upcoming game against Arsenal and the necessity of breaking down lower-block teams.
